"Online grocery shopping has boomed since the pandemic began in 2020, with
Woolworths and Coles steadily expanding their home-delivery offerings. Rapid
delivery is the latest frontier.

Woolworths and Coles Express have been offering on-demand deliveries through
UberEats and Doordash since last year. Woolworths recently launched the Metro60
app which promises home delivery within an hour to select suburbs.

These arrangements have received little fanfare, yet they signal a significant
shift for supermarket workers.

As part of ongoing research, I study how the gig economy is transforming
conditions of work within traditional employment. To find out how interacting
with delivery platforms affects supermarket employees, I interviewed 16
experienced “personal shoppers” at Woolworths and Coles who fill delivery
orders from supermarket shelves."
